leetcode 504. 七进制数(Java版)
生活随笔
收集整理的這篇文章主要介紹了
leetcode 504. 七进制数(Java版)
小編覺得挺不錯(cuò)的,現(xiàn)在分享給大家,幫大家做個(gè)參考.
題目
https://leetcode-cn.com/problems/base-7/
題解
經(jīng)典的進(jìn)制轉(zhuǎn)化。此思路可以拓展至 10 進(jìn)制轉(zhuǎn) n 進(jìn)制。
public class Solution {public String convertToBase7(int num) {int n = num;if (num < 0) n *= -1;if (num == 0) return "0";StringBuilder sb = new StringBuilder();while (n != 0) {sb.append(n % 7);n /= 7;}if (num < 0) sb.append("-");return sb.reverse().toString();} }總結(jié)
以上是生活随笔為你收集整理的leetcode 504. 七进制数(Java版)的全部?jī)?nèi)容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: leetcode 501. 二叉搜索树中
- 下一篇: leetcode 506. 相对名次(J